Average Hourly Rates for Home Care in Carlisle

In Carlisle, PA, the standard rate for professional non-medical home care ranges from $13.00 to $16.00 per hour. This rate covers essential services such as personal care, companionship, meal preparation, light housekeeping, and medication reminders. Financial Assistance: The CHC Medicaid Waiver

Many families are unaware that they may qualify for financial assistance to cover home care costs. Pennsylvania's Community HealthChoices (CHC) is a Medicaid managed care program designed to help seniors and individuals with physical disabilities remain living in their homes. If your loved one qualifies for the CHC waiver, their home care services may be fully covered at no cost to the family. This waiver is accepted by major managed care organizations, including UPMC Community HealthChoices, AmeriHealth Caritas, and PA Health & Wellness.

How to Budget for In-Home Care

To effectively budget for home care, start by calculating the number of hours of support required each week. For instance, a part-time schedule of 20 hours per week at $13.00 to $14.50 per hour would cost approximately $260 to $290 per week. Many families begin with minimal hours and gradually increase support as needs change. Does Medicare pay for non-medical home care in Pennsylvania?

Standard Medicare does not cover non-medical in-home care (like light housekeeping or companionship). However, Pennsylvania's Medicaid Community HealthChoices (CHC) waiver does cover these services for eligible individuals.
